General logic is constructed from understanding, judgement, and reason. Logic is what’s used to deal with concepts, judgement, and inferences.
Reasoning is something that extends to knowledge beyond possible experience, meaning you can reason something that is not in any way something you can experience.
Judgement is better at indicating the nature of the task. To find out how you end up making a choice.
Logic however doesn’t contain rules for judgement, logic just leads to knowledge as it is the connection for all the pieces of things you know in your head.
Judgement as it is an action can only be practiced and not taught, and poor judgement is what often leads to stupidity.
A narrow minded person although can teach themselves or be taught with alot of knowledge can still make very poor decisions, as their judgement is flawed. Its not hard to find people in this archetype.
